All the received manuscripts are first screened by the editors as to their scope and quality as well as to check compliance with the scope, quality and submission policies of the journal. This phase confirms that the manuscript is complete, follows formatting rules and meets the ethical standards, including authorship, disclosures and data integrity. This is because in terms of editorial screening, problems are detected early hence delay in peer review is minimized and only appropriate manuscripts will go through the evaluation process. This will help to make the workflow more efficient and ensure that the quality of all submissions is the same.

Editory Press follows a metadata-first publishing approach to ensure that every article is supported by accurate, standardized, and machine-readable information from the beginning of the publication process. This includes author details, affiliations, abstracts, keywords, references, and citation metadata, together with export options such as RIS and BibTeX for compatibility with reference management systems and academic databases. High-quality metadata plays a critical role in improving article discoverability, citation accuracy, and long-term accessibility. By supporting structured metadata and widely used citation export formats, we help research integrate more effectively with search engines, indexing services, library systems, and scholarly tools used across the academic publishing ecosystem.

Each journal defines its peer review model and author requirements on the journal page. Submissions are evaluated for scope and quality before external peer review.
Initial screening (1-3 days), reviewer invitation and assignment (about 1 week), peer review (2-4 weeks), and an editorial decision often within 6-8 weeks.
Open access makes your research immediately available to readers worldwide. Licensing determines how others can reuse your work with appropriate attribution.
The exact license is stated on each journal page. Authors typically retain copyright, while granting reuse rights under the journal's chosen Creative Commons license.
APC status may vary by journal. Please check the journal page for the current policy.
If a journal charges an APC, the amount and waiver options are stated clearly in its author information.
Waivers may be available for authors without institutional funding or from eligible regions. Requests are evaluated case-by-case according to the journal's policy.
